Alberni Agricultural Water Plan
(2024 - 2025)
Upland was contracted by the Alberni-Clayoquot Regional District to develop an Agricultural Water Plan following the creation of the Alberni Valley Agricultural Plan in 2011. Two of the goals set forth in the Agricultural Plan speak directly to the objectives of this project: Goal 7: Improve the Productivity of the Land Base and Goal 12: Increase the Availability of Water for Agriculture. The ACRD received funding through the Investment Agriculture Foundation BC’s Agricultural Water Infrastructure Grant Fund to develop this Agricultural Water Plan for the Alberni Valley.
The project's scope includes identifying and quantifying agricultural water opportunities within Electoral Area ‘B’ - Beaufort, Electoral Area ‘D’ - Sproat Lake, Electoral Area ‘E’ - Beaver Creek, Electoral Area ‘F’ - Cherry Creek, and the City of Port Alberni. Land in the Agricultural Land Reserve (ALR) and non‐ALR land that may have agricultural viability based on soil classification were considered within the scope of analysis (see Section 3 for more details). A mix of irrigation equipment types, based primarily on crop feasibility and viability, were also included in the modelling.
